做LINUX运维都需要掌握什么?
生活随笔
收集整理的這篇文章主要介紹了
做LINUX运维都需要掌握什么?
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
運維需要用到的東西很雜,從硬件設備到軟件維護。
硬件設備 比如服務器的安裝 網絡的部署布局 ,最好能夠了解防火墻,路由器,交換機的設置。
linux系統的深入了解。最好能夠深入到內核和代碼層面
部署在linux服務器上的應用的了解和維護,比如tomcat apache weblogic nagios cacti等。包括開發人員編寫的軟件,都需要去進行維護和調優建議,最好了解js和java語言。服務器的各種使用情況的監控,如磁盤,cpu,mem,io等。
架構設計的了解,以及自動化運維的腳本編寫。
比如搭建集群或負載模式的架構等,實現服務器的多機熱備高可用。
腳本編寫,以減少人力操作來提高執行效率和準確性,一般需要shell,python,perl一類的語言基礎,也包括awk,except等小語種使用。
數據庫的維護
熟悉主流的數據庫操作,主要是添刪改查的操作。
oracle,mysql,芒果db,db2,memcache,redis等
您好,現階段如果只會linux運維,在找工作市場是沒有太大優勢的。但您參考我們的課程大綱來看看做linux運維需要掌握什么。
第一階段:網絡基礎
第二階段:Linux基礎
第三階段:Linux運維自動化
第四階段:數據庫運維管理
第五階段:企業級云架構管理與綜合實戰
第六階段:就業指導
總結
以上是生活随笔為你收集整理的做LINUX运维都需要掌握什么?的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 交通备案是什么意思?
- 下一篇: 盒马如何抢菜